Inégalité des chances is a quirky comedy that dives into the absurdity of life’s inequalities. Geneviève Delouche brings her signature style, blending sharp wit with a lighthearted tone that softens its more serious undercurrents. The pacing is playful, keeping you chuckling while still allowing for moments of reflection on social issues. Performances are a mix of charm and cheek, with an ensemble cast playing off each other beautifully, creating a vibrant atmosphere. The practical effects add a nice touch, enhancing the comedic moments without overwhelming the narrative. It’s not just laughter; there's a thoughtful critique hiding beneath the surface that makes it stand out in the comedic landscape of 2017. Worth a watch if you're into films that balance humor with a bit of social commentary.
